The short answer

A harmful low-pressure interaction between Crataegus monogyna and indapamide has not been established. Check the species and preparation with your pharmacist before use.

Common-name hawthorn evidence has limits

A study reporting a small diastolic pressure reduction used Crataegus laevigata, a different species from C. monogyna. It did not demonstrate an indapamide-specific interaction. That result cannot be assigned automatically to your exact herb.

Other research does not settle the question

A short trial of a standardized leaf-and-flower extract found no dose-related pressure reduction. It excluded people taking blood-pressure medicines and did not clearly identify the species in its product description. It therefore cannot establish safety or a low-pressure interaction with indapamide.

Identify the product before using it

Check the Latin name, plant part, extraction details and other ingredients. The European monograph covers several hawthorn species and defined leaf-and-flower preparations; it is not a clinical test of every fruit extract or C. monogyna product. Ask your pharmacist to review the label.

Use your blood-pressure plan as the guide

Because indapamide lowers pressure, discuss adding hawthorn if your readings are already low or you have dizziness or near-fainting. There is no established indapamide-specific safe dose or hours-apart schedule. Seek assessment for fainting or persistent symptoms rather than treating them with another supplement.

Source 1: Current U.S. prescribing information

dailymed.nlm.nih.gov · Source check Sep 10, 2026

Population: Patients prescribed oral indapamide 1.25 or 2.5 mg tablets; additional dose-ranging study data.

Recommends periodic electrolyte and renal-function assessment. Potassium reductions were dose-related; some low measurements normalized without intervention. Calcium increases in indapamide studies were only slight. Includes a thiazide-like magnesium-loss warning.

How this applies: Exact medication guidance with explicit dose and nutrient distinctions. Exact indapamide RxCUI 5764 IN, confirmed by current NLM properties. Oral indapamide dose and release formulation are retained; evidence for hydrochlorothiazide, other diuretics or combination antihypertensive products is not automatically equivalent.

A label class warning is not proof that every patient has magnesium depletion or that routine supplements are required. Higher-dose risks and other diuretics cannot be assigned to every low-dose regimen.

Source 2: Original clinical research

ebi.ac.uk · Source check Sep 10, 2026

Population: 21 adults with prehypertension or mild hypertension; antihypertensive users were excluded.

No significant dose-response in blood pressure or flow-mediated dilation; adverse symptoms were uncommon.

How this applies: Adjacent hawthorn evidence only; absence of exact identity and co-use limits applicability.

Very short study, no indapamide users, and botanical species not specified in the inspected product description. Cannot be promoted to exact C. monogyna evidence.

Source 3: Original clinical research

pubmed.ncbi.nlm.nih.gov · Source check Sep 10, 2026

Population: 79 adults with type 2 diabetes; 71% used hypotensive medicines.

Small average diastolic reduction, no significant systolic difference; no herb-drug interaction detected.

How this applies: Explains why common-name hawthorn evidence does not establish the exact C. monogyna claim.

C. laevigata is a different species; no exact indapamide subgroup. Average lowering is not demonstrated excess hypotension.
